The Malaysian branch of a Japanese multinational system integration company announced that it surging ahead with plans to expand data centre capabilities across the Asia Pacific and the wider world, with enhancements in Malaysia and Indonesia now months away.
In Malaysia, the company is currently constructing a fifth data centre at its Cyberjaya campus, located 30km away from the centre of Kuala Lumpur. The new Cyberjaya 5 facility will house 5.6 MW of “critical IT load” and will come online during the fourth quarter of 2020 to meet the requirements of hyper-scalers and high-end enterprise customers.
Meanwhile, the firm’s new campus in Indonesia will be capable of 45 MW of critical IT load once fully developed. Under the banner of Indonesia Jakarta 3 Data Centre, the new facility is expected to become the largest data centre in Indonesia with plans in place to open during the first half of 2021.
In addition to Southeast Asia, new data centre capabilities will also be launched in India, Japan, the UK, Germany and the USA, providing over 400 megawatts (MW) of IT load upon completion.

Malaysia’s data centre market expected to expand
Malaysia’s data centre market size is likely to reach revenues of over $800 million by 2025. Malaysia is also expected to gain increased traction for data centre investments owing to the land shortage faced by Singapore to facilitate greenfield developments.
The expansion by hyperscale across other Southeast Asian countries is likely to lead to an increase in investments in Malaysia. Over 80% of the population has access to the Internet, the data traffic in Malaysia Internet Exchange is around 35 Gbps per day, which is expected to grow at about 5-10% YOY between 2020 and 2025.
The Malaysian government has planned to generate 20% renewable energy by 2025. To achieve the target, an $8 billion investment is required for the renewable energy sector from the public-private partnerships and private financing. The increase in digital transformation initiatives by enterprise verticals will aid the growth of PaaS and IaaS providers, thereby boosting the market growth.
Several Malaysian and Chinese enterprises have planned to establish an Artificial Intelligence park at a cost of $1 billion. The aim is to build a commercial AI ecosystem, increase artificial intelligence talent, and grow AI-related research initiatives in Malaysia.
The Malaysia national industry 4.0 framework has designated initiative programs to adopt IoT, sensor technology, artificial intelligence/machine learning (AI/ML), mobile connectivity, robotics, and 3-D printing.
Infrastructure projects such as the National Fiberisation and Connectivity Plan (NFCP) are to be implemented by the government to improve inland connectivity across Malaysia in the next five years.
